Added
- Reconfigure config flow to update Husqvarna Application Key and Client Secret without removing the integration (#372)
- Clearer 429 rate-limit error handling during credential validation
Fixed
- WebSocket reconnection now uses conservative exponential backoff (30s, 60s, 120s... up to 15min) instead of aggressive 5s retries that burned through the Gardena API quota of 700 req/week (#370)
- WebSocket URL request (
POST /v2/websocket) now handles 429 responses and respectsRetry-Afterheader instead of blindly retrying (#370)